Mask
38527
From: Canada | Ontario | Grand River
Curatorial Section: American
| Object Number | 38527 |
| Current Location | Collections Storage |
| Culture | Iroquois |
| Provenience | Canada | Ontario | Grand River |
| Culture Area | Northeast Culture Area |
| Section | American |
| Materials | Wood | Brass | Horsehair | Pigment |
| Technique | Painted |
| Description | "Wood, with brass eyes. Wrinkled forehead, twisted mouth, pointed chin. Horsehair hair. Painted red with black eyebrows and mouth." (catalogue card); Handwritten on card - "Crooked-mouth Mask" representing "the Great One" (Fenton - A.F.E) |
| Length | 33 cm |
| Width | 18 cm |
| Credit Line | Pan-American Exposition; Wanamaker Expedition / R. Stewart Culin, 1901 |
